Transaction eac73beeea126b8a7e1c01671a5d936ff8950cd1ef185fe847967f3b851de954

1 Input
2 Outputs
  • eac73beeea126b8a7e1c01671a5d936ff8950cd1ef185fe847967f3b851de954:0
  • value  919526
    address  39aETsvWbXLECVToAnewCGLC4VyxaRgFeY
  • eac73beeea126b8a7e1c01671a5d936ff8950cd1ef185fe847967f3b851de954:1
  • value  1937676932
    address  3AQ4kUjQaDjCjmDh2ojKEHjUKTSi52UUqD